These events were generally mild to moderate in severity and included: Nausea often accompanying changes in bowel habits, particularly after dose escalation Diarrhoea loose or watery stools, sometimes with urgency Vomiting less common but reported, especially at higher doses Constipation occurring in some individuals, reflecting the variable effect on gut motility Abdominal discomfort or bloating a sensation of fullness or cramping Flatulence increased wind, which can accompany altered digestion Gastrointestinal adverse events were the most common reason for discontinuation in the Phase 2 trial, occurring in approximately 510% of participants depending on dose group

Why Medical Supervision Matters BPC-157 and TB-500 are often sold online as research peptides or research chemicals. These products may not be intended for human use and may carry risks related to purity, contamination, incorrect dosing, mislabeling, or unsafe administration
